How Does a Hydraulic Power Pack Work?
Hydraulic power packs work by following the principles of fluid dynamics and mechanical force transmission, converting mechanical energy from a motor into hydraulic energy through a pump. The process begins when the motor drives the hydraulic pump and pressurises the hydraulic fluid stored in a reservoir. This creates a powerful and controlled fluid flow, that is directed through control valves to regulate the flow and pressure.
The actuators help in converting the hydraulic energy back into mechanical energy, aiding in performing tasks like lifting, pushing, or rotating. When the fluid returns to the hydraulic reservoir, it becomes ready to be pressurized again. This loop produces enough energy capable of powering a variety of different industrial applications.
Key Features of Hydraulic Power Pack Systems
The key features of a hydraulic power pack include:
- Compact Design: It is designed to save space while at the same time generating high power energy.
- Customizable: Hydraulic gear pump manufacturers mostly customise them based on the needs, such as pressure and flow rate. This can be further readjusted.
- Durable Components: This equipment is quite durable and can withstand any unfavourable condition that may arise during the time of its operation.
